Problem
Service application parties face inconvenience when using heterogeneous blockchain network architectures due to constraints of different networks, requiring a solution to simplify operations and improve efficiency across multiple blockchain systems.
Innovation Solution
A transaction request construction method and apparatus that generates a standard transaction request using a unified standard key and converts it into a target transaction request suitable for specific blockchain architectures, allowing seamless processing across various blockchain networks without needing to consider different data structures or account systems.

Provided are a transaction request construction method and apparatus, a transaction request processing method and apparatus, a device and a storage medium, which relate to the field of blockchain technology and can be used for cloud computing and cloud services. A specific implementation includes: generating a standard transaction request according to a standard key of a service application party, to-be-processed request data, a target blockchain architecture to be accessed and a target blockchain identifier; and calling a transaction conversion service and converting the standard transaction request into a target transaction request under the target blockchain architecture according to the standard key, the target blockchain architecture and the target blockchain identifier; where the target transaction request is used for processing the to-be-processed request data. Transaction request construction and processing efficiency can be improved.
